Join us for all the build-up and action as it happens from today’s Serie A games, starting with Milan-Sassuolo before Udinese-Napoli, Fiorentina-Verona, Genoa-Inter and Bologna-Juventus.

We begin at 12:30 CET (11:30) GMT with the lunch-time match between Milan and Sassuolo.

The Rossoneri are the joint-Serie A table leaders alongside Napoli. The Partenopei will visit Nicolò Zaniolo’s Udinese later today at 15:00 CET.

Fiorentina host Verona at the same time, and it’s a big game in Florence as the Tuscans sit at the bottom of the table with no victories so far this season. The Gialloblù are the closest team in the standings as they have just three points more than La Viola.

Cristian Chivu will visit his former Roma teammate Daniele De Rossi at Marassi in Genoa-Inter at 18:00 CET, while Luciano Spalletti’s Juventus will travel to Bologna for a tricky fixture at the Dall’Ara.

Inter, Napoli, Milan and Bologna will also be involved in the Supercoppa Italiana Final Four next week.

Juan Cabal came off the bench to snatch all three points for Juventus against 10 men, continuing the dire Bologna record in this fixture, and leapfrogging them into fifth place.
